RESPONSIBILITIES

Strategic HR Partnership: -Act as a HR advisor to assigned department leadership, translate business and production goals into workforces plans and support organizational change restructuring and productivity initiatives.Workforce Planning & Recruitment: - Plan manpower needs for production, operation, maintenance and technical roles. Ensure timely recruitment and onboarding of newly employed staff of your assigned department.Employee Relation & Compliance: - Manage disciplinary actions, grievances, and conflict resolution within the department. Ensure compliance with labour laws, union agreements and company policies.Performance Management: -Drive performance reviews cycles for the staff in the department, train line managers on performance management and support development plans for high performer and critical roles. Learning & Development: - Identify skill & technical gaps and liaise with the training manager to coordinate trainings.HR Operations & Reporting: - Analyse HR Metrics (Turnover, absenteeism, overtime, Safety and headcount. Prepares workforce and compliance reports for management.Engagement, Culture & Wellbeing: - Lead employee engagement initiative of the assigned department. Promote safe, inclusive and productive workplace culture. Support wellbeing, attendance management and retention strategies.
